What is a Pragmatic Demonstration?
A pragmatic demonstration is a practical and tangible exhibit or presentation that showcases the real-world application of a theoretical principle or innovation. Unlike conventional theoretical discussions, pragmatic demonstrations offer a hands-on, experiential approach to learning and understanding. They are designed to be available, appealing, and actionable, enabling individuals to see the instant advantages and potential of the principle being shown.

Applications of Pragmatic Demonstrations
Science and Research
In clinical research, pragmatic demonstrations are vital for confirming theories and models. For instance, a physicist may show the principles of quantum entanglement utilizing a basic, observable experiment, or a biologist may use a microscopic lense to reveal the habits of cells in real-time. These presentations not just help scientists understand the phenomena they are studying however also make intricate clinical principles accessible to a more comprehensive audience.
Service and Technology
In the service and innovation sectors, pragmatic presentations are used to display new products, services, and procedures. A tech business might show the abilities of a new software tool through a live interface, while a start-up may provide a model of a new device to potential financiers. These demonstrations are important for getting buy-in, drawing in funding, and driving adoption.
Education
In education, pragmatic presentations are a powerful tool for teaching and knowing. Educators may use demonstrations to explain clinical principles, historical occasions, or mathematical ideas. For circumstances, a chemistry instructor might carry out a laboratory experiment to highlight a chain reaction, or a history instructor could utilize a virtual truth simulation to bring a historical event to life. These interactive experiences can substantially boost student engagement and retention.
Healthcare
Pragmatic demonstrations are also essential in health care, where they can help physician and clients comprehend new treatments, technologies, and treatments. For instance, a surgeon may use a 3D design to discuss an intricate surgical treatment, or a pharmacist might demonstrate the correct use of a new medication. These presentations can improve patient results by guaranteeing that both health care companies and clients have a clear understanding of the processes involved.
Environmental Science
In ecological science, pragmatic presentations can be used to raise awareness and promote sustainable practices. For example, a presentation of a photovoltaic panel system can demonstrate how sustainable energy works and its benefits, while a hands-on workshop on composting can educate individuals about decreasing waste and improving soil health.
Techniques of Pragmatic Demonstrations
- Live Demonstrations: These are real-time, in-person presentations where the audience can observe and interact with the idea being provided. Live presentations are extremely interesting and can offer immediate feedback.
- Virtual Demonstrations: With the development of innovation, virtual demonstrations have actually become increasingly popular. These can be performed through webinars, virtual truth, or enhanced truth, allowing a broader audience to take part from anywhere in the world.
- Case Studies: Case research studies are a form of pragmatic demonstration where real-world examples are used to illustrate the application of a theory or concept. They provide an in-depth, contextual understanding and can be especially efficient in organization and management.
- Prototype Testing: In product advancement, models are typically used to demonstrate the feasibility and functionality of a new style. This approach enables iterative screening and enhancement, making sure that the final item meets the desired requirements.
- Interactive Workshops: Workshops that combine presentations with hands-on activities are an effective method to engage individuals and cultivate a deeper understanding. These can be particularly efficient in academic and training settings.
